Output 321d93e147c0821c0ae417ae8da83a881bbb0578e8c7c41be21d8f856fffc27a:1

value
1153607
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3cf45ea9339efd051b850eca79439f2a1ab897de OP_EQUALVERIFY OP_CHECKSIG
address
16ZJHcuXBjQVq5EThmJkZszk6tN2DH6Aoe
transaction
321d93e147c0821c0ae417ae8da83a881bbb0578e8c7c41be21d8f856fffc27a
confirmations
399878
spent
true